Portugal's new waiting‑list management system for the National Health Service (Serviço Nacional de Saúde or SNS) will go live on 1 August, outlets report. The rollout aims to centralise how hospitals record and prioritise patients on surgical and specialty waiting lists; officials say the change is intended to improve tracking and reduce delays. The move should eventually change how appointments and expected wait times are communicated, so those on specialist lists or awaiting procedures should watch for new correspondence from their hospital or health centre.
